[spoiler]Act III Finale Archive: https://www.bungie.net/en/Forum/Post/242853482/0/0[/spoiler] "Shift change," Lee announces. He watches from the top of a nearby ridge as Cabal soldiers jump off of the turrets mounted around the main entrance before their psion spotters follow suit. The guard shift changes occur like clockwork, but the next shift up always seems to lag and trickle in at an uneven pace. This is what Lee had counted on though: mixing confusion on top of a delayed response would hopefully buy the infiltration team enough time to find the Exo prisoner and make their escape. Bee slows her pike near a small cluster of rocks to the opposite flank of the entrance. The Onyx Guard hops off the side of the vehicle as Bee yaws slightly to keep him beyond the reach of the engine exhaust. His position is near enough for one of the pikes to divert during their escape, but still maintaining enough distance to prevent the Cabal from pinpointing his location. Bee then heads off to join Patterson, who waits in a large artillery crater with his pike on low impulse to conceal it's location. "In position," she broadcasts to Lee and the Onyx Guard as she gives a nervous thumbs up to Patterson. Lee responds to give them a heads up to their approach. "Next turret crew is starting to come out. Brown nosing psion from last shift is still on lookout, but the turrets aren't up yet. I'll put it down once Big O calls in his sat; should buy a few more seconds. We all ready?" "Ready." "Ready." Patterson briefly exhales to steady himself, "Ready." "Dropping the Hammer." The air around them fell into an almost perfect silence, as though the world itself was preparing for the impending storm of death and destruction. A blast of deafening fury erupted on a level to rival the warhorns of Heaven as the beam fell on the imperial land tank. It rips through the machine before being redirected to cleave through its forward bridge. "Go!" Bee shouts as she throttles her pike and takes lead; the additional armor bulked up at the front as Patterson stays directly behind her, the armor of his pike bolstered in the rear to cover the Exo during the escape. Lee fires at the psion lookout, aiming to wound. He wants to remove the threat while adding to the confusion: the Cabal step over the dead, but still try to aid their injured. The round meets its mark to the upper thigh, dropping the psion and forcing it to crawl to cover. Cabal pour from the burning land tank, desperately fleeing toward the safety of their fortress. The Onyx Guard lines up another shot, dropped the initial strike just before the fortress and dragging the beam back toward the land tank. Cabal scatter in all directions as the beam cuts through the fleeing crowd. Residual heat of the beam adding to its area of effect by causing the Cabal's breathing systems to rupture as their comrades burn. Bee takes full advantage of her front heavy pike, plowing her way through crowds of terrified enemies and casually grazing the walls as she makes her way down the narrow walkways of the fortress. Her only objective: wreak havoc and drive reinforcements away from the detention ward. Patterson cautiously makes his way in on foot. He doesn't intend to draw attention to himself, and can't afford to have anything follow him to interrupt his escape. He reaches a terminal after looking through small slits on the doors of holding chambers and releases the cell holding the captive Exo. She is injured, severely: one eye shattered by an impact that caved in left side of her face, the remnants of a left shoulder and upper arm showing the crude signs of the arm being physically pulled off, and dangling feet loosely hanging from both shins that had been collapsed inward by the impact of a blunt object. "Guardian? What are you doing?" she sputtered as her voice struggled to form the words. Patterson walks over and reaches down to gently lift her shattered frame. "Getting you away from this hell hole," he replied after scooping her up in his arms, allowing her remaining right arm to drape over his left shoulder to stabilize herself. "The guards. There are too many guards. Land tank coming. Leave me.." she pleaded. She struggled to turn her head toward Patterson, revealing the cracked lens of her remaining eye. "We're dealing with the backup," he reassured her. "Bee, time to go," he called over the radio. "Copy that," Bee chirped back. "Lee, can you still cover the turn and burn or do I need to make hole?" "Calm down," Lee barked back. "Not every wall needs a hole in it." He peers toward the interior of the base through his scope and takes aim at a fuel cell previously highlighted by Jackson. "Say when." Patterson positions the Exo on the back of his pike and makes the call: "do it." Lee fires at the fuel cell creating a blinding light. The Onyx Guard sees this and fires a brief Hammer strike to clear the immediate area around the main gate. Bee shoots from the interior of a building and Patterson quickly follows her through the gate. They break formation as Bee turns to retrieve the Gear and Patterson breaks toward the dropship awaiting in the distance. A few moments later, all five are aboard the ship and are breaking the Martian atmosphere. "Help me with this," Patterson directs. The Onyx Guard makes his way over to assist securing the Exo into one of the jumper seats. He looks over the damage. It will take time, but there is no doubt she can be repaired, and he will gladly supply the Tower with the tools needed to do so. "We made it!" Bee shouts. The Exo can't help but smile at her excitement. Lee looks back from the cockpit and asks sarcastically, "we picking up anymore hitchhikers along the way? One more and I won't have to arm wrestle for the last can of a 6-pack." "Thank you," the Exo let's out quietly, the smile still visible on the right side her face. She sits back, finally able to relax as her nightmare ends.
